java main() javamain函数中调用方法 一、调用方法: main(args); 1. 二、举例: public static void main(String[] args) { int a=new Random().nextInt(100)+1; //1-100 System.out.println(a); //输出a if (a<10) System.exit(0); //小于10正常退出 main(args); //自调用 } 1. 2. 3...
main()称之为主函数,是所有程 序运行的入口。其余函数分为有参或无参两种,均由main()函数或其它一般函数调用,若调用 的是有参函数,则参数在调用时传递。 main() { ... y1=f1(x1,x2); ... } f1(int a,int b) { ... Y2=f2(x3,x4); ... } f2(int m,int n) { ... ... } 1. 2...
1.创建一个对象来调用本类中的非静态函数方法 publicclassDemo{voidadd(){ System.out.println("我被调用啦"); }publicstaticvoidmain(String[] args){Demodemo1=newDemo(); demo1.add(); } } 注意:没有对象的时候,不可以调用非静态函数 publicclassDemo{voidadd(){//非静态函数System.out.println("我...
public class Main { public static void main(String[] args) { System.out.println("Hello, World!"); } } 复制代码 编译该类:在命令行中执行 javac Main.java 运行该类:在命令行中执行 java Main 这样就会调用main方法并执行其中的代码。如果有参数需要传递给main方法,可以在运行时在java命令后面添加...
在main函数中,我们可以调用其他方法来完成程序的各种功能。 调用方法有两种方式:静态调用和动态调用。 静态调用是指在编译时就确定了调用的方法,使用类名.方法名的方式进行调用。例如: ``` public class Main { public static void main(String[] args) { int result = Calculator.add(1, 2); System.out....
1. 编写Java的main函数 Java程序的入口点是 public static void main(String[] args) 方法。这个方法必须被声明为 public 和static,且没有返回值(void)。 2. 在main函数中创建一个对象(如果需要的话) 如果被调用的方法是非静态方法,你需要先创建该类的实例(对象)。这是因为非静态方法属于类的实例,而不是类...
这是Linux上的调用栈,通过JavaCalls::call_helper()函数来执行main()方法。栈的起始函数为clone(),这个函数会为每个进程(Linux进程对应着Java线程)创建单独的栈空间,这个栈空间如下图所示。 在Linux操作系统上,栈的地址向低地址延伸,所以未使用的栈空间在已使用的栈空间之下。图中的每个蓝色小格表示对应方法的栈...
通过调用其他方法,我们可以在main方法中实现多种功能。 在调用方法之前,我们需要先定义方法。方法是一段可以重复使用的代码块,它封装了特定的功能。定义方法的语法如下: ``` 访问修饰符返回值类型方法名(参数列表) { 方法体 } ``` 其中,访问修饰符可以是public、private、protected和默认四种。返回值类型可以是...
Main方法是用static修饰的,有2种方法可以调用 1.类名.main(参数); 2.new创建实例,实例.main(参数); 这个地方注意必须传递字符串数组的参数 或者 null ! --- 另外举一个用反射机制调用Main方法的例子 这个类是被调用的main方法类: public class Run { public static void main(String[]...
在Java中,每个程序都必须包含一个主函数(main)。主函数是程序的入口点,它是程序执行的起点。当我们运行Java程序时,JVM(Java虚拟机)会自动搜索并执行程序中的主函数。主函数有固定的格式,一般定义为public static void main(String[] args)。 如何调用其他类中的函数?